Who We Are:
PBR is the world’s premier bull riding organization. More than 1,000 bull riders compete in more than 200 events annually across the televised PBR Unleash The Beast tour (UTB), which features the top bull riders in the world; the PBR Pendleton Whisky Velocity Tour (PWVT); the PBR Touring Pro Division (TPD); and the PBR’s international circuits in Australia, Brazil, and Canada. In 2022, PBR launched the nationally televised PBR Teams league—eight teams of the world’s best bull riders competing for a new championship expanding to 10 teams in 2024—as well as the PBR Challenger Series with more than 60 annual events nationwide. The organization’s digital assets include PBR RidePass on Pluto TV, which is home to Western sports. PBR is a subsidiary of TKO Group Holdings, Inc. TKO Group Holdings, Inc. (NYSE: TKO) is a premium sports and entertainment company. TKO owns iconic properties including UFC, the world’s premier mixed martial arts organization; WWE, the global leader in sports entertainment; and PBR, the world’s premier bull riding organization. Together, these properties reach 1 billion households across 210 countries and territories and organize more than 500 live events year-round, attracting more than three million fans. TKO also services and partners with major sports rights holders through IMG, an industry-leading global sports marketing agency; and On Location, a global leader in premium experiential hospitality.
Position Summary
The Transportation & Logistics Manager is responsible for the day-to-day management, compliance, and execution of all fleet and logistics operations supporting the Professional Bull Riders (PBR) tours. This role ensures the safe & efficient movement of equipment, materials, and operational assets across multiple national touring schedules.
Reporting to the Senior Director of Tour Operations, this position oversees fleet operations, regulatory compliance, and logistics coordination, while partnering closely with other members of the Tour Operations, Production, and Risk Management departments. The Manager also supports warehouse operations and budget management, ensuring all transportation, warehousing, and logistics functions operate at a high standard of safety, reliability, and cost efficiency.
